What does Type A vs Type B mean?
Type A. Serious citation. Imminent or substantial risk to children. The regulator requires corrective action immediately and may impose a civil penalty.
Type B. Lower-severity citation. Corrective action required, no imminent risk. The regulator monitors compliance on the next visit.

- 87465(d)Type A
Assist PRN administration when symptoms unclear
Based on record review, the licensee did not comply with the section cited above in one out of two residents does not have this in the file, which poses an immediate health, safety or personal rights risk to persons in care.
- 87465(h)(5)Type A
Keep prescriptions in original containers
Based on observation, the licensee did not comply with the section cited above in one out of two has their medications prepared two days in advance and two out of two has their medications prepared for a week in advance which poses an immediate health, safety or personal rights risk to persons in care.
